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 150°C (302°F) with top and bottom heat. Place an empty casserole dish inside to warm it.
  2. Core the tomatoes and cut into small pieces. Peel and crush the garlic cloves. Mix the tomatoes and garlic together, then season with salt, pepper, and oregano. Chop the basil and parsley finely and stir them into the mixture along with the cream cheese.
  3. Clean the oyster mushrooms. Heat olive oil in a large pan over medium-high heat, add the mushrooms, season with salt and pepper, and cook for 4–5 minutes until golden. Remove and set aside to keep warm.
  4. Cut the beef fillet into slices about 2 cm thick and season with pepper. In the same pan over medium-high heat, fry each slice for about 1 minute on each side until browned. Peel the red onion, cut into rings, and fry for 2–3 minutes until softened.
  5. Transfer the beef slices to the warmed casserole dish. Arrange the fried mushrooms and onion around them. Spoon the tomato mixture over the beef, sprinkle with grated Gouda cheese, and bake for 20 minutes until heated through. Serve hot.
